Days and Months

Days of the week and months of the year start with a capital letter​ in English:

M​onday, T​uesday, W​ednesday, T​hursday, F​riday, S​aturday, S​unday

J​anuary, F​ebruary, M​arch, A​pril, M​ay, J​une, J​uly, A​ugust, S​eptember, O​ctober,

November, D​ecember

Ordinal Numbers to Say the Date


In English, we use ordinal numbers to talk about dates.

We make ordinal numbers by adding “th” at the end.

We say dates in two ways:

the ​+ ordinal number + of ​+ month the ​seventh of ​October

month + ordinal number December twenty-fifth

Important

Exceptions

1 first

1 January We do not say “oneth January”​.​ We say “the first of January​​” or

“January first​​”.

2 second

2 February We do not say “twoeth February”​.​ We say “February second​​” or

“the second of February​​”.

3 third

3 March We do not say “threeth March”. ​ We say “​March third​”​ or “​​the third

of March​”​
5 fifth

8 eighth

9 ninth

12 twelfth

“y​” “ie​”

In the numbers 20 (twenty​), 30 (thirty​), 40 (forty​), etc., the letter “y​” becomes “ie​” in

the ordinals:

20th (twentie​th), 30th (thirtie​th), 40th (fortie​th), etc.

Saying the Year in English


In English, we often split the year into two parts:

19​75​ nineteen ​seventy-five​

From 2000 to 2009 (2001, 2002, etc.), we usually don’t split the year:

2001​ two thousand (and) one​

From 2010 and onwards, we split the year again:

20​11​ twenty ​eleven ​

or

2011 ​ two thousand (and) eleven​​
